温馨提示×

centos下如何借助copendir

小樊
44
2025-11-05 21:44:24
栏目: 智能运维

在 CentOS 系统中,copird 并不是一个标准的命令或程序。可能您是想问 cpio,这是一个用于创建和解压缩归档文件的工具。以下是如何在 CentOS 下使用 cpio 的基本指南:

安装 cpio

大多数 CentOS 版本默认已经安装了 cpio。如果没有,可以使用以下命令安装:

sudo yum install cpio

创建归档文件

使用 find 命令结合 cpio 来创建一个归档文件。例如,将 /home/user/documents 目录下的所有文件打包到一个名为 documents.cpio 的归档文件中:

find /home/user/documents -print | cpio -o -H newc > documents.cpio
  • find /home/user/documents -print:查找 /home/user/documents 目录下的所有文件并输出它们的路径。
  • cpio -o -H newc:使用 cpio 创建一个新的归档文件,-H newc 指定归档格式为 newc
  • > documents.cpio:将输出重定向到 documents.cpio 文件。

解压缩归档文件

使用 cpio 解压缩一个归档文件。例如,解压缩 documents.cpio 文件到 /tmp/documents 目录:

mkdir -p /tmp/documents
cpio -id < documents.cpio
  • mkdir -p /tmp/documents:创建目标目录 /tmp/documents
  • cpio -id < documents.cpio:使用 cpio 解压缩归档文件,-i 表示解压缩,-d 表示创建目录结构。

其他有用的 cpio 选项

  • -v:显示详细信息(verbose),即在处理文件时显示文件名。
  • -p:仅提取文件,不创建目录结构。
  • --quiet:静默模式,不显示任何信息。

例如,使用详细模式解压缩归档文件:

cpio -idv < documents.cpio

希望这些信息对您有所帮助!如果您有其他问题,请随时提问。

0